Israeli suspected of beating man he mistook for potential attacker
An Israeli man is suspected of beating a person he thought to be a potential Arab attacker carrying a firearm in Jerusalem sometime last night.
The victim, an armed Israeli Jewish man, was hit repeatedly with a metal rod and is said to be hospitalized in moderate condition.
The suspect is a 28-year-old ultra-Orthodox man, according to Walla.
He was taken into custody and released to house arrest today.
